What do we treat? Here is a variety list, but not complete.

  • Speech, language, voice, and articulation therapy 

  • Swallowing and feeding therapy 

  • Physical therapy 

  • Occupational therapy 

  • Orthotic assessments 

  • FEES - Fiberoptic Endoscopic Evaluation of Swallowing

  • MBSS - Modified Barium Swallow Study 

  • Wheelchair assessments and customized hardware 

  • Augmentative and Alternative Communication (AAC) evaluation and prescription

  • Individual therapy sessions 

  • Group therapy sessions 

  • NICU follow-up services 

  • Bioness Integrated Therapy System (BITS)

One example of our collaborative efforts is our Go Baby Go partnership with the CMU Engineering Department. Each year, several local children with unique needs are chosen as the recipient of this mobility project. Then, the teams of therapists and providers work with engineering students (and additional CMU students) to design and build a custom battery-powered kid car. These motorized cars are fun! But more importantly, they are designed to meet the needs of the child. These needs could include specialized seating supports or include cargo space for respiratory or feeding equipment. The power and steering are modified to be accessible for the child as much as possible. This is an amazing collaboration that challenges CMU students to create solutions and is a blessing to families.
